Japan is intensifying its efforts against financial scams. Police will now use decoy online accounts to track illicit money flows.

Japan is ramping up its fight against money laundering, a move that indirectly benefits tourists by making the country a safer destination. The new strategy involves police creating fake online bank accounts to lure scammers.

This allows law enforcement to monitor the movement of illegally obtained funds. By tracing these transactions, authorities aim to identify and apprehend criminals more effectively.

While this initiative primarily targets domestic financial crime, a safer financial environment benefits everyone. Tourists are less likely to fall victim to scams and fraud during their travels.
